UE's Chris Townsend Debates Republican Over Attacks on Unions

February 20, 2012

On February 18, UE's Political Action Director Chris Townsend appeared on the program "Inside Story" on the global TV news network Al Jazeera. The topic of the 25-minute program was "Attacking Unions." The host asked whether Mitt Romney was politically smart to be attacking unions in the campaign for the Michigan Republican presidential primary, but the focus quickly broadened to a discussion of unions and their role in American politics. The other two guests were Jason Johnson, a political science professor, and "Republican strategist" J.P. Freire.

Townsend went toe-to-toe with Friere, dismantling the Republican's attacks on labor. The GOP representative got particularly uncomfortable when Townsend shifted the discussion to the misdeeds of the banks and financial services corporations that wrecked the economy in what Townsend called "the worst corporate crime wave in history." Townsend also made clear that, while the efforts of Republicans to destroy unions is our primary concern, UE is by no means satisfied with the "inconsistent" support labor has received from Democrats.
